You'll play a key role in delivering electrical and control system designs for complex engineered solutions, working closely with internal departments and external stakeholders to ensure projects meet customer, regulatory, and technical standards.

EC&I Engineer- The Role:

Supporting the tendering process, reviewing specifications, and preparing deviation lists
Selecting electrical components and preparing Bills of Materials (BOMs) for skid packages
Producing and maintaining detailed EC&I documentation (P&IDs, instrument lists, I/O lists, cable schedules, interconnection diagrams)
Ensuring compliance with ISO9001 and ISO3834 quality systems
Preparing FAT and SAT documentation and supporting test activities
Liaising with internal teams — including sales, production, and purchasing — to deliver projects on time and to specification

EC&I Engineer- The Person:

Degree or HND qualified in Electrical, Control, or Instrumentation Engineering (or equivalent experience)
Minimum 3 years' experience in a similar design or project engineering role
Confident working within highly regulated industries (e.g. Oil & Gas, Nuclear, Defence)
Familiarity with ATEX and machinery safety standards desirable
Experience with AutoCAD or other electrical design software (training can be provided)
Additional PLC software knowledge would be advantageous
UK passport preferred (due to the nature of project work - ability to obtain SC required)

The core element of this role is electrical design, however should you have additional PLC Software ability that would be advantageous.
